Professional Experience and Previous Roles
Mitchell Bakos has a diverse professional background. He worked as Chief Technology Officer at Professional Publications, Inc. from 2002 to 2011 in the San Francisco Bay Area. He also held the position of Director of Research and Development at McCue Systems from 2000 to 2002. Prior to that, he served as Senior Systems Consultant at KeyCorp/KeyBank from 1995 to 2000 in the Albany, New York Area. His experience includes leadership roles at GPSL, where he was Vice President Client Services from 2019 to 2021 and Chief Technology Officer from 2011 to 2020 in the United Kingdom.
Education and Expertise
Mitchell Bakos has a strong educational foundation in engineering and project management. He earned a Master of Science in Electrical Engineering with a focus on Computer Engineering from Cleveland State University. Additionally, he studied Advanced Project Management at Stanford University. His expertise encompasses a range of technologies, including programming and database technologies such as Java, Oracle 11g, and MySQL, as well as AI technologies like Natural Language Processing, Analytics, and Image Recognition.
